Comprehending Weather Patterns
Knowing weather patterns involves examining the energetic interactions between atmosphere masses of different conditions, pressures, and dampure levels. These communications result in different atmospheric phenomena, including cloud formation, wind habits, and temperature variations. High-pressure systems typically bring clear heavens and calm circumstances, while low-pressure methods are linked to be able to cloudy skies plus strong winds.

Challenges In Predicting Weather Changes
Predicting climatic conditions changes presents quite a few challenges due to the normal complexity of atmospheric dynamics. The connections between air herd, pressure systems, plus dampure content produce a highly variable environment that is hard to model precisely. Although advances found in technology, including satellite television imagery and advanced computer models, the particular chaotic nature of weather systems means that even small errors in primary data can result in substantial deviations in predictions.
Also, the effect of global phenomena such as Este Niño and La Niña adds one more layer of unpredictability. These events can alter weather habits on a large scale, generating it harder to offer accurate long-term estimations. Our understanding involving these phenomena will be still changing, and their impacts may vary widely depending about other concurrent atmospheric conditions.
